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
Basic Metal Finishing - Most frequently, metal polishing is desirable for appearance and clean-room usages. It really is among the most preferred methods because of its utility in intensifying the overall beauty of the item, such as, motor bike parts, kitchenware or car parts. Aside from that, many clean-rooms demand a burnished finish to lower the perviousness of the components which might cause debris to build up and contaminate. A really good example of this implementation could be in vacuum chambers. You will discover a lot of strategies to polish metal, and now we're going to take a look at a bit in relation to a few of the steps required. Metals can be polished manually by hand, using purpose made buffing machines, electromechanically or chemically. A finishing compound or paste is usually utilized, that may contain chalk, chromium oxide, limestone, aluminum oxide, dolomite, tripoli, or iron oxide. Finishing stainless steel, due to its lousy th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its reasonably high viscosity is typically one of the most time intensive. On the other side, products manufactured from non-ferrous metals tend to be receptive to buffing, as they need the lowest number of treatments.
Where a superior processing quality will not be called for, swifter pad speeds can be used. A slower pad speed can be used any time a superior quality mirror finish is expected. Finishing buffs covered in paste will be very much affected by specific forces on the finishing pad. The concentration of the pressure on the surface may be heightened within certain levels, though exceeding the maximum degree of pressure not simply decreases the quality of treatment, but additionally worsens effectiveness, might lead to wear on the part, and also an evident heating up of the objects being worked on, brought about by friction. With thinner items, it will be elevated temperature (and a relating flexibility of the material) that causes components to warp, buckle or distort. Typically, it needs an educated polisher to add in all of these fundamentals to equally prevent damage to the workpiece and to perform the task efficiently. To help you substantially enhance the standard of the resultant surface area, the finishing procedure should really be done with a reduced amount of aggression and not a large amount of pressure so as to consequently deliver a surface with no scores or fine lines due to the the polishing procedure, subsequently arriving at a lovely mirror finish.
